Number of UK millionaires signals end of financial 'abyss'

Britain is now home to more than 280,000 millionaires representing some £1.3trn in wealth, according to the latest research, in an indication the UK's economic health is improving.

A study conducted by London-based CoreData Research UK in July and August suggests the UK boasts 284,317 sterling millionaires, representing 1.1% of UK households. "The number of millionaires is partly a reflection of the economic opportunity that exists in modern Britain and should allow others to seize their own chance to grow a business, be successful and boost economic growth," says CoreData Research principal Craig Phillips.
